Historical Context: The Roots of the Rivalry

To truly appreciate the Corinthians vs Palmeiras rivalry, it's crucial to understand its historical context. The rivalry's roots delve deep into the social and cultural fabric of São Paulo, tracing back to the early 20th century. The establishment of both clubs reflects the rich tapestry of immigration and social change that characterized Brazil at the time. Corinthians, founded in 1910, emerged as a club representing the working-class neighborhoods of São Paulo. Its founders, a group of railway workers, envisioned a team that would embody the spirit and resilience of the common people. The club's name, a tribute to the English club Corinthian FC, reflects the ambition and international influences that shaped Brazilian football in its early years. Palmeiras, on the other hand, was established in 1914 by Italian immigrants who sought to create a club that would represent their community and heritage. Initially named Palestra Italia, the club played a significant role in fostering a sense of identity and belonging for the Italian diaspora in São Paulo. The club's colors, green, white, and red, mirrored the Italian flag, further emphasizing its cultural roots. The early encounters between Corinthians and Palestra Italia were marked by intense competition, reflecting the social and cultural tensions of the time. The matches became symbolic clashes between different communities, each vying for dominance and recognition. The passion and intensity surrounding these games quickly established the foundation for one of Brazil's most fierce rivalries. Players Who Defined the Derby

Throughout its rich history, the Corinthians vs Palmeiras derby has been graced by players who defined the rivalry. These individuals, through their skill, passion, and dedication, have left an indelible mark on the fixture, becoming legends in the eyes of their respective fans. They are the players whose names are synonymous with the derby, the heroes whose performances are etched into the memory of every fan. For Corinthians, names like Sócrates, the legendary midfielder and physician, immediately spring to mind. His intelligence, elegance on the ball, and commitment to social causes made him a symbol of the club and a hero to the Fiel. He embodied the spirit of Corinthians, a club known for its fighting spirit and its connection to the working class. Another iconic figure for Corinthians is Rivellino, a flamboyant winger known for his powerful shot and his distinctive mustache. He was a key player in the Corinthians team of the 1970s, a period of great success for the club. His skill and flair made him a fan favorite, and he remains a revered figure in Corinthians history. For Palmeiras, Ademir da Guia, known as the Divino (the Divine One), is a name that resonates with every fan. He was an elegant midfielder with exceptional vision and passing ability, leading Palmeiras to numerous titles in the 1960s and 70s. He is considered one of the greatest players in Palmeiras history, a symbol of the club's golden era. Another Palmeiras legend is Evair, a prolific striker who scored crucial goals in the derby, including the winning goal in the 1993 Campeonato Paulista final, ending the club's 16-year title drought. His name is synonymous with that historic victory, and he remains a beloved figure among Palmeiras fans.
